Output 00918d384fcab9af35318c5259b2264d60385b9b0d3c6467b967009c96730793:66

value
129900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19a1225870548915ac81f94cf043fa37dcbe435c OP_EQUAL
address
342Xr8vLueHDeYCaF5X6niDfGZu5gYvUFK
transaction
00918d384fcab9af35318c5259b2264d60385b9b0d3c6467b967009c96730793
spent
true